Two killed, five injured in tractor accident



KATHMANDU: Two people have died in separate road accidents in Saptari and Tanahun districts in the country.

An 18-year-old Ram Ashish of Kanchanrup-11, Theliya died after a tractor, Pradesh-02-01-001 Ta 0032, met with an accident near a canal on the inner road, said District Police Office, Saptari.

Other four people sustained injuries in the accident.

Similarly, a 36-year-old Keshav Darlami died in a tractor accident at Lyutpakha in Anbukhaireni rural municipality-2 on Thursday.

The accident took place when a tractor, Ga 1 Ta 3770, heading to Anbukhaireni from Chhimkeshwari turned turtle on Chhimkeshwari-Anbukhaireni road section.

Lila Bahadur Yadi of Anbukhaireni sustained injuries in the accident, said Police Inspector of Area Police Office, Anbukhaireni.
